Construction Change Order Best Management Practices. Definition of a construction change order: A construction change order is work that is added to or deleted from the originally agreed upon and contracted scope of work which alters the original contract amount and/or completion date. Why Choosing the Right Delivery Method Matters in Construction. While a project’s ultimate goal is a successful completion, the steps it takes to get there are critical to profits and project’s life cycle. That’s why choosing the right projectdelivery method is an important first step before construction begins.

OpenJOC, a term coined by Four BT, LLC, is the deployment of Job Order Contracting based upon LEAN construction delivery best management practices. OpenJOC leverages processes, standardized cost data , and technology to drive win-win relationships among all project participants and on-time, on-budget, quality construction outcomes.

HVACie is an information exchange specification for the life-cycle capture and delivery of information needed to describe Heating, Cooling, Ventillating (and Refrigeration) systems.
